NOTE
lDo not use glass cleaner or suspend
objects on or around the light sensor.
Otherwise, light sensor sensitivity
will be affected and may not operate
normally.

Automatic transmission
To turn the key from the ACC to the
LOCK position, the shift lever must be in
the P position.

M (Manual)
M is the manual shift mode position.
Gears can be shifted up or down by
operating the shift lever or steering shift
switches.
Refer to Manual Shift Mode (page 5-13).

NOTE
This defroster is not designed for
melting snow. If there is an
accumulation of snow on the rear
window, remove it before using the
defroster.

Antenna
qRear Window Antenna
The rear window antenna receives both
AM and FM signals.
